Key Market Issues

Children (Kids & Babies) in the US represent just over 20% of the population; however, they are responsible for 22% of the Artisanal Ice Cream market. The proportion of Children that consume Artisanal Ice Cream is low at about a third, but this is still higher than the Oldest Adults at 20%. Take-home Ice Cream represents over half of the Ice Cream market in the US. Any changes in consumption rates or encouragement of new consumers in this category will therefore have more of an impact on the overall market than similar changes in the other categories. The population of the US is fairly evenly split between Males and Females; however, Females consume approximately 15% more Ice Cream than Males in all categories. Marketers should consider gender based marketing to benefit from this split.

Key Highlights

Older Consumers represent 27% of the value share of the Impulse Ice Cream market in the US, followed by children with 20% share. Marketers need to ensure that their campaigns target both areas of the market to maintain and further encourage these consumers as well as attempting to encourage consumption in the middle age groups. With the exception of one retailer, which accounts for almost 30% by value, the Ice Cream market in the US is fragmented. This gives producers some bargaining power with retailers. Private Label products have small but significant shares in the Impulse and Take-home Ice Cream markets in the US. The remainder of these markets is fairly evenly spread among national brands. There is still some room for Private Label growth among some of the smaller brands. Marketers of these brands need to differentiate their brands in order to prevent becoming a target of Private Label competition.
